◈ Case Study · Jeddah Waterfront Destination
Jeddah Waterfront Destination — Reading the Disconnected Waterfront
01 Problem Definition · Stages 1–2

Reading the Disconnected Waterfront

The workflow opens by diagnosing the site: a waterfront physically and visually cut off from the city — fragmented edges, weak gateways, exposed open land and an underutilised marina. The board maps every constraint and opportunity that the destination concept must resolve.

Jeddah Waterfront Destination — Strategic Insights, Opportunities & Constraints
02 Site Analysis · Stages 3–5

Strategic Insights, Opportunities & Constraints

Strategic intelligence over the real parcel: high-value waterfront zones, destination nodes, development potential and movement corridors weighed against heat exposure, coastal risk and operational-sensitivity areas — the evidence base for the masterplan.

Jeddah Waterfront Destination — Objectives, Principles & Guest Experience
03 Design Framework · Stages 6–14

Objectives, Principles & Guest Experience

The destination's design DNA — objectives, principles and measurable KPIs: an ≥80% accessible waterfront, ≥60% shaded area, activity nodes at 150–250m, climate-comfort corridors and a continuous guest experience along the water's edge.

Jeddah Waterfront Destination — Land Use, Mobility & Climate Strategy
04 Hospitality Masterplan · Stages 15–28

Land Use, Mobility & Climate Strategy

The resolved masterplan: land-use zoning across public waterfront, active retail/F&B edge and mixed-use districts, woven with a walkability and cycling network, primary entry plazas, breeze corridors and a green-and-blue climate strategy.

Jeddah Waterfront Destination — The Waterfront, Realised
05 Resolved Destination Fabric · Stages 29–34

The Waterfront, Realised

An eye-level and aerial read of the developed waterfront fabric — accommodation blocks, shaded promenades, marina edge and landscaped public realm resolved into a coherent, walkable hospitality destination along the Corniche.

Jeddah Waterfront Destination — The Destination at Golden Hour
06 Cinematic Visualisation · Stage 35

The Destination at Golden Hour

The signature hero render — the full Jeddah Waterfront Destination at golden hour: marina, resort promenade, pools and landmark frontages reading as one premium, internationally competitive coastal destination.

Design Intelligence

Saudi / Gulf Hospitality & Tourism Design Rules

12 non-negotiable principles governing quality hospitality & tourism design in the Saudi and Gulf context. Every prompt generated by this system is built on these foundations.

🏛️
Destination Identity
Every project must express a clear Saudi/Gulf sense of place through landscape, architecture, materiality, cultural narrative and guest experience — generic international resort forms are rejected.
🛬
Arrival Experience
The sequence from approach road to drop-off, reception, lobby and first view must be memorable, legible and operationally efficient.
🧭
Guest Journey
The system structures the full journey — arrival, check-in, rooms, villas, dining, wellness, leisure, events, cultural experiences and departure.
🔐
Public / Private / Service Separation
Guest areas, VIP zones, family areas, staff movement, loading, waste, laundry, kitchens and maintenance must be clearly separated.
☀️
Climate Comfort
Outdoor spaces prioritise shade, air movement, thermal comfort, water-sensitive landscape, night-time usability and seasonal flexibility.
🕌
Cultural Authenticity
Local identity is translated into contemporary hospitality experience — not copied as superficial ornament.
🌅
View & Landscape Value
Rooms, villas, restaurants, lounges, terraces, pools and public decks maximise views and environmental assets.
🚪
Back-of-House Efficiency
Service access is invisible to guests but efficient for operations, deliveries, maintenance, emergency access and staff circulation.
🌙
Night-Time Activation
The destination supports evening social life through lighting, F&B, events, shaded promenades and safe pedestrian movement.
💰
Revenue-Supporting Program
The masterplan supports rooms, villas, F&B, wellness, retail, events, cultural experiences, branded residences and leisure activities.
♻️
Sustainability & Resource Logic
Water, energy, cooling, waste, landscape and materials respond to Saudi climate and long-term operating costs, referencing Mostadam Communities and Commercial systems.
🎯
Vision 2030 Alignment
The project supports tourism growth, local identity, job creation, private-sector investment and quality-of-life objectives.
